Output ef59d1bac2dd74bf2e90b8ac3202ce4e6d15fbd057e24870aa6f7502a1f05682:1

value
328200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7b54d3dc4eac7788a41391aee8fb2e5f9de712e OP_EQUAL
address
3MMaPrN4Bzq4u7mEvDVAkdnhHBbDoSty9r
transaction
ef59d1bac2dd74bf2e90b8ac3202ce4e6d15fbd057e24870aa6f7502a1f05682
confirmations
285631
spent
true